MASTS Webinar: Towards Automated Cliff-Nesting Bird Monitoring using Machine Learning

MASTS is pleased to host a webinar featuring the work of Charis Hanna, a PhD student at the University of St Andrews.

Towards Automated Cliff-Nesting Bird Monitoring using Machine Learning

Cliff-nesting seabird colonies are difficult to survey manually at the frequency and scale needed for robust population monitoring. We present new machine learning methods for automated detection and counting of cliff-nesting birds, designed to scale to colony-level and population-wide monitoring without requiring new manual annotation for each site. We test these methods on imagery collected at the Isle of May, showing their potential as a practical tool for long-term seabird monitoring.

 

Charis is based at both the Scottish Oceans Institute and the School of Computer Science. Charis' work looks at developing novel deep learning approaches for the automated monitoring of dense cliff-nesting bird colonies. Her research focuses on advancing computer vision methods for detection, classification, and behavioural analysis in challenging habitats.
